The helicopter shot is a powerful batting stroke where the player uses a circular, wrist-heavy flick to hit a low ball into the air. The bat finishes with a full 360-degree rotation above the player’s head, much like a helicopter blade spinning.
Example: The finisher won the game by using a helicopter shot to smash a fast yorker over the long-on boundary.
Pro-Tip: This shot was made famous by MS Dhoni and is specifically designed to score off very low, difficult balls.
